Magnetic resonance angiographic evidence of sex-linked variations in the circle of willis and the occurrence of cerebral aneurysms.
Journal of neurosurgery - 1 Apr 2002
Horikoshi Toru, Akiyama Iwao, Yamagata Zentaro, Sugita Masao, Nukui Hideaki
Abstract excerpt
OBJECT: In this study the authors investigated the relationship between variations in the circle of Willis observed on magnetic resonance (MR) angiograms and locations of cerebral aneurysms, and evaluated the risk of aneurysm formation. METHODS: One hundred thirty-one patients with cerebral aneurysms were retrospectively selected from a series of 4518 patients who underwent MR angiography at one neurosurgical...
